Marley Bauce
Managing Director, Geballe Laboratory for Advanced Materials
BioMarley Bauce joined Stanford in January 2023 as the Managing Director or the Geballe Laboratory for Advanced Materials (GLAM), one of 15 independent and transdisciplinary labs within the Office of the Vice Provost and Dean of Research. In this role, he provides managerial, financial, facilities, strategic planning, and research administrative support for GLAM’s faculty, trainees, and administrative staff, while optimizing the vibrancy, interconnectivity, and safety of materials research across the university.
Prior to joining Stanford, Marley spent a decade at Columbia University, first as the Director of Research Development within the Office of the Executive Vice President for Research, then most recently as the inaugural Associate Dean for Research at the Climate School, where he created and led an 11-person Office of Research spanning compliance, grants administration, federal affairs, and strategic initiatives. Over his tenure at Columbia, he directly supported and wrote “center grant” proposals awarded $100M+ in federal funding.
Marley has an MPA in Management & Finance from Columbia University, an MA in Environmental Studies from NYU, and a BA in Philosophy from Hampshire College. -
Magdalene Bedi
Industrial Contracts Officer 1, Office of Technology Licensing (OTL)
BioMagdalene is an Industrial Contracts Officer in the Office of Technology Licensing. Prior to joining Stanford, Magdalene practiced law as an attorney external to the University, primarily serving startup, technology, and creative industry clients on transactional matters related to venture capital investments, intellectual property, data privacy, and US regulatory compliance. She received her B.A. in Interdisciplinary Studies: Communications, Legal Institutions, Economics, and Government from the American University in Washington, DC, and her J.D. from the University of California College of the Law, San Francisco (formerly UC Hastings). She is admitted to practice law in the State of California.

Michael Edward Bellas
Licensing Associate, Life Sciences, Office of Technology Licensing (OTL)
BioMichael joined OTL in November 2024 as a Licensing Associate on the Life Sciences team. Prior to joining Stanford, Michael worked in business development within the life sciences industry, focusing on strategy, patent filing, and licensing opportunities. He also prepared and negotiated agreements for technology licensing and collaboration with academic partners. Michael holds a B.S. from the University of California, Berkeley.
